No Place for Statements Like This

Statement by Montgomery County Human Rights Commission on Demeaning Advertising Placed in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ority Locations

October 31, 2012

“Recently, an organization called The American Freedom Defense Initiative (AFDI) placed the following ad within the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ority (WMATA) system:

‘In any war between the civilized man and the savage, support the civilized man. Support Israel. Defeat Jihad.’

“Although the Courts have found that this is protected political speech, realistically, when it is read as a reasonable person would read it, the AFDI ad plainly depicts Muslims – the primary adherents to this tenet of Islam – as ‘savages.’ This demeaning of a group of people based on religion or national origin and ancestry, is hateful and reprehensible. It does nothing to promote dialogue and, in fact, has the opposite effect.

“Montgomery County Executive Ike Leggett has issued a statement in response to this ad that clearly states that Montgomery County residents have no use for this kind of intolerance. We fully support the County Executive’s position.

“The Montgomery County Human Rights Commission works to eliminate discrimination, prejudice and intolerance, and to promote goodwill, cooperation, understanding and human relations among all residents. The hateful rhetoric expressed in the AFDI ad not only demeans the Muslim community but offends all of us. The Commission condemns this offensive language and requests that the AFDI remove or modify its ad and engage in civil discourse rather than hateful expressions.

“There is no place for statements like this in Montgomery County, and the Human Rights Commission will react vigorously to support any group or individual targeted in this manner.”
